OTA 231 — Occupational Therapy: Methods and Modalities II

3 credits · 3 hours

This course assists advanced students to master occupational therapy treatment techniques. Students learn the application of occupational therapy techniques in simulated therapy situations; review and develop treatment plans, evaluations and documentation reports; and, practice written and verbal communication used in the practice of occupational therapy. The course consists of two hours of lecture and three hours of laboratory per week.

Prerequisites: OTA 101, OTA 131
